Details of Dell 3.2TB NVMe 2.5inch U.2 SSD
Manufacturer Details
- Brand: Dell
- Model Number: K60N7
- Device Category: Solid-State Drive (SSD)
Storage Specifications
- Capacity: 3.2TB (3200GB)
- Flash Type: Triple-Level Cell (TLC) 3D V-NAND
- Interface: U.2 (SFF-8639)
- Protocol: PCIe 3.0 x4 NVMe
- Form Factor: 2.5-inch Small Form Factor
- Drive Class: Enterprise / PM1725b Series
- Mount Type: Internal Enclosure

Compatible Dell Server Platforms
Sled and Blade Server Compatibility
- Dell PowerEdge FC630
- Dell PowerEdge FC640
- Dell PowerEdge FC830
- Dell PowerEdge M620
- Dell PowerEdge M630
- Dell PowerEdge M640
- Dell PowerEdge M820
- Dell PowerEdge M830
- Dell PowerEdge MX740c
- Dell PowerEdge MX750c
- Dell PowerEdge MX840c
Rack Server Compatibility
- Dell PowerEdge R440
- Dell PowerEdge R630
- Dell PowerEdge R640
- Dell PowerEdge R650xs
- Dell PowerEdge R6525
- Dell PowerEdge R730xd
- Dell PowerEdge R740xd
- Dell PowerEdge R7425
- Dell PowerEdge R750
- Dell PowerEdge R750xa
- Dell PowerEdge R750xs
- Dell PowerEdge R7515
- Dell PowerEdge R7525
- Dell PowerEdge R840
- Dell PowerEdge R930
- Dell PowerEdge R940
- Dell PowerEdge R940xa
Tower and Modular Server Compatibility
- Dell PowerEdge T550
- Dell PowerEdge T630
- Dell PowerEdge T640
- Dell PowerEdge XR2

Dell K60N7 3.2TB NVMe U.2 PCIe Gen3 TLC SSD Overview
The Dell K60N7 3.2TB NVMe 2.5-inch U.2 PCIe Gen3 TLC Solid State Drive represents a high-performance storage solution designed for enterprise and data center environments. Leveraging NVMe technology, this drive provides exceptional read and write speeds, low latency, and superior endurance. Built on Triple-Level Cell (TLC) NAND, it balances cost-effectiveness with reliability, making it suitable for a wide range of workloads from intensive transactional databases to read-heavy applications. The 2.5-inch form factor with U.2 interface ensures compatibility with modern server architectures while maintaining a compact footprint.
Performance Characteristics of Dell K60N7 SSD
NVMe PCIe Gen3 Interface
The Dell K60N7 utilizes the PCIe Gen3 interface to deliver significantly higher bandwidth compared to traditional SATA SSDs. With multiple lanes dedicated to data transfer, the drive achieves consistent high-speed performance across demanding workloads. NVMe protocol minimizes latency by reducing overhead, ensuring faster input/output operations per second (IOPS) and better overall system responsiveness. This makes the drive ideal for high-performance computing, virtualization, and enterprise applications where speed is critical.
Read and Write Speeds
With sequential read speeds approaching 3,100 MB/s and write speeds up to 2,000 MB/s, the Dell K60N7 3.2TB SSD provides rapid data access for intensive applications. Random read and write IOPS performance is optimized to handle multiple simultaneous requests, ensuring smooth operation in multi-user environments. These performance metrics are especially beneficial for database operations, real-time analytics, and virtual machine storage, where latency and throughput directly impact productivity and operational efficiency.
Latency and Responsiveness
The NVMe protocol significantly reduces latency compared to legacy SATA interfaces. Dell K60N7 SSDs offer sub-millisecond access times, which enhances overall server responsiveness and application performance. Low latency contributes to faster data retrieval and processing, reducing bottlenecks in I/O-intensive environments. This feature is critical for workloads such as online transaction processing (OLTP) systems, artificial intelligence models, and data analytics platforms.
Capacity and Storage Efficiency
High-Capacity Storage Options
The 3.2TB capacity of the Dell K60N7 SSD provides ample space for enterprise-grade applications, virtual machines, and large datasets. This high-density storage solution enables organizations to consolidate workloads, reduce hardware requirements, and improve data management efficiency. Additionally, the drive supports over-provisioning, which enhances endurance and maintains consistent performance even under heavy workloads.
Data Protection and Endurance
Built with enterprise-grade TLC NAND, the Dell K60N7 SSD ensures high endurance suitable for mixed-use workloads. The drive features advanced error correction algorithms and wear-leveling technology, which prolong the lifespan of the SSD and protect critical data. Power-loss protection mechanisms ensure that data remains safe in case of unexpected interruptions, reducing the risk of data corruption and maintaining system reliability in mission-critical environments.
Reliability and Longevity
The Dell K60N7 is engineered for continuous operation in enterprise environments, with mean time between failures (MTBF) ratings designed to meet rigorous reliability standards. Its robust design withstands high-temperature fluctuations and sustained workloads, making it an optimal choice for data centers and cloud infrastructure where uptime and durability are paramount.
Form Factor and Compatibility
2.5-Inch U.2 Form Factor
The 2.5-inch U.2 form factor of the Dell K60N7 SSD combines compact size with enterprise-grade connectivity. U.2 connectors provide hot-swappable capabilities, enabling easy maintenance and upgrades without server downtime. The small form factor makes it compatible with a wide range of Dell PowerEdge servers and other enterprise-grade storage solutions. This form factor also allows for high-density storage configurations, helping organizations maximize rack space and reduce overall data center footprint.
Server and Platform Integration
Designed to seamlessly integrate with Dell enterprise servers, the K60N7 SSD supports native hardware monitoring and management features. This ensures optimal drive performance and reliability through firmware updates, health monitoring, and predictive failure alerts. It is compatible with a wide range of server models, operating systems, and virtualization platforms, providing a flexible storage solution for enterprise IT environments.
Ease of Deployment
Deploying the Dell K60N7 SSD is streamlined with industry-standard tools and management software. IT administrators can monitor drive health, performance, and firmware updates centrally, reducing operational complexity and ensuring that drives remain optimized throughout their lifecycle. Hot-swappable design and plug-and-play support simplify installation in densely packed server environments.

Advanced Features and Technologies
TLC NAND Technology
The use of Triple-Level Cell NAND in the Dell K60N7 SSD strikes a balance between cost, performance, and endurance. TLC NAND allows higher data density per chip, providing large storage capacities while maintaining reliable performance. Advanced error correction and wear-leveling algorithms mitigate the potential drawbacks of TLC NAND, such as write amplification, ensuring long-term reliability for enterprise workloads.
Power Efficiency and Thermal Management
The Dell K60N7 SSD incorporates efficient power management techniques that reduce energy consumption while maintaining peak performance. Thermal throttling mechanisms prevent overheating, ensuring consistent operation in dense server environments. Efficient thermal management prolongs the lifespan of the drive and supports stable performance under continuous high-intensity workloads.
